Planning ahead makes your trip smoother. Pack light layers to adjust to cooler temperatures. Don't forget a jacket, comfortable walking shoes, and an umbrella for unexpected light rains. A camera or smartphone assists in capturing the beauty around you. Carrying a small bag with these essentials ensures that you are prepared for any weather surprises along the way.

Most travelers find that a 3 to 5 day stay is ideal for hill station trips. This duration gives you enough time to wander, explore, and relax. A short trip can work well for a quick getaway, while a longer vacation lets you dive deeper into local culture and nature. Planning your schedule with time for both leisure and adventure provides the best experience during your September break. It ensures that you enjoy every moment without feeling rushed.

Places like Shimla, Munnar, and the Valley of Flowers are among the best hill stations to visit in September. They are chosen for their pleasant weather and scenic beauty.
Hill stations such as Leh, Spiti Valley, and Auli tend to experience colder temperatures in September. These spots are ideal for travelers who love cool weather.
Shimla, Manali, Ooty, and Darjeeling are four of the most iconic hill stations in India. They are celebrated for their charm, history, and natural beauty.
Hill stations like Nainital, Mussoorie, and Lansdowne are popular choices near Delhi. They offer a quick escape into nature during September.
Destinations like Almora, Kalpa, and Chikmagalur are praised as peaceful mountain getaways for autumn. They attract travelers looking for tranquility away from the hustle of city life.
